Dutty water will out fyah.
“Dirty water will put out fire.”
Everything has its use, however humble or unclean it may seem.
— Traditional Virgin Islands Wisdom, U.S. Virgin Islands

A crab never forgets its hole.
There is no place like home; people never truly forget where they came from.
All fish bite, but the shark gets the blame.
Those with a history of bad behavior are blamed first, even when others are equally guilty.
Dirty hands make a greasy mouth.
Hard work brings its own reward; those who labor will eat well.
Studyation is better than education.
Common sense and lived wisdom can matter more than formal schooling.
Every day is a fishing day, but not every day is a catching day.
Effort must be made consistently, even though results are not guaranteed every time.
Once a man, twice a child.
In old age, people can return to childlike dependence and behavior.
